Q: How do staff open the shuttle-bus gate at the Corvessa campus?
A: The gate on Milner Way serves the Greyfield shuttle only, running every twenty minutes during core hours. Drivers cannot open it from the bus, so facilities staff handle access at peak times. Report faults to the duty supervisor before overriding anything. To release the gate manually, enter the code listed below.

staff pass of kawip-hawef = bdg-QLP-2

## Environments

The Pagewren catalogue importer runs nightly against the Murdock Lane library feed. Staging mirrors production but points at a scrubbed snapshot, so don't panic if record counts differ. Heads-up for review: the importer writes with elevated privileges during the merge phase. Here are the environment settings currently active in staging.

service settings:
[casax]
port = 6379
team = rusir
host = casax.zemvarhq.corp
region = outer-4
access_code = ac_9808ce
timeout_ms = 1500

Minutes — Management Meeting, Branch Managers

Attendees reviewed the Q3 cash-flow forecast prepared by Hennick Falls finance. Receivables from the Tarwood contract slipped one month, tightening October liquidity; mitigations include deferred fleet purchases and accelerated invoicing at all branches. Dorsa Klein will circulate revised targets Friday. Branches should flag variances above five percent immediately. The confidential planning note is set out below.

board note of bafog-taduf: Gross margin on Oliath came in at 5 percent against a plan of 5 percent. Only 9 of the 120 pilot accounts renewed Oliath, so a churn review is set for January 15.